If you’re a Cox Communications customer, you’ll be able to watch Fox Business Network on or after Dec. 30.
The station will be available to digital subscribers on Ch. 253, Cox’s Sarah Kauffman said.
FBN launched in October 2007 and is available in 45 million homes in major markets across the United States.
